|
|
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Как организовать свой поиск по сайту(но не гугл), если это web проект и контент находится в jsp файлах??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.11.2013, 23:02:44 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
organism, а можете скинуть конкретный пример с применением lucene?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.11.2013, 23:33:23 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Fyn2013, с таким подходом к разработке сайта тебе лучше кому-то заплатить чтоб за тебя всё сделали.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.11.2013, 23:50:07 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
причём тут заплатить 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.11.2013, 23:53:52 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Hibernate Search 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 28.11.2013, 23:57:22 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
rdm, ооо, вот это помощь, спасибо вам!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 29.11.2013, 01:24:22 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Fyn2013organism, а можете скинуть конкретный пример с применением lucene? Ты Solr-то скачай, там примеры будут...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 29.11.2013, 01:46:22 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
а если у меня контент в jsp файлах, а не в базе данных, solr разве подойдёт для поиска по контенту на сайт? и до выхода в жизнь солра, что использовали в java проэктах для поиска?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 29.11.2013, 23:09:02 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Fyn2013, Как вариант, сделать HTTP-запрос и получить содержимое нужной страницы, например, при помощи URLConnection : http://docs.oracle.com/javase/tutorial/networking/urls/readingWriting.html Код: java 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.11.2013, 07:21:30 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Fyn2013а если у меня контент в jsp файлах, а не в базе данных, solr разве подойдёт для поиска по контенту на сайт? и до выхода в жизнь солра, что использовали в java проэктах для поиска? Главное, чтобы у тебя были данные в каком-то структурированном виде, который он понимает. Потому что ему данные нужно будет скормить для индексации. Например, подойдет Json. Если у тебя нет данных в чистом виде, только текст html, тогда наверное и затевать все это бессмысленно...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.11.2013, 09:06:27 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Usman, а вот эта тема для поиска что вы подсказали URL oracle = new URL(" http://www.oracle.com/") неплохая, но там он ищет только по конкретному адрессу, и если мне надо найти слово со странички например http://www.oracle.com/new , то он уже не найдёт слово нужного мне на ней, так же? это надо в коде задавать массив страничек всех? или я не знаю чего-то может пока что?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.11.2013, 20:07:23 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Fyn2013это надо в коде задавать массив страничек всех?Да, задается список всех необходимых URL'ов в массиве/списке и поочередно/параллельно для каждого выполняется запрос.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.11.2013, 20:33:44 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Usman, ок, это получилось, но так ищется просто ж слово из массива ссылок. А возможно чтобы таким образом поиск осуществить - например Поисковая фраза "автоматика" найдена в разделе: Выставочно-консультационный центр т.е. чтобы показать ссылку на раздел, где нашлось это слово..возможно такое с помощью URL сделать, не применяю solr и других поисковиков?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.12.2013, 13:29:41 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Fyn2013, URLConnection'у нужен адрес и все, он может открыть несуществующую страницу и в ответе получить ошибку 404. У Вас должен быть заранее сформирован список валидных адресов, по которым нужно пробежаться. P.S. Вы пытаетесь прикрутить поиск по страницам для своего сайта?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.12.2013, 13:41:05 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Usman, да, пытаюсь, но не хочу запихивать контент в базу данных и разбираться в solr=) вот я сделал такой код, но мне ещё надо прикрутить логику туда, чтобы он находил не только слово, но и указывал ссылку на раздел сайта, где это слово найдено: Код: java 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. 33. 34. 35. 36. 37. 38. 39. 40. 41.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.12.2013, 14:21:23 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Fyn2013, Код: java 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.12.2013, 15:09:21 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
да, но если if (search(argi[i], word)) { // Найдена фраза в argi[i]'ом разделе } то argi[i] - это он покажет "Найдено в разделе http://localhost:8080/site/home ", а как чтобы отобразилось "Найдено в разделе Автоматика " ? ну чтобы не просто адрресс показался, а название странички по этому адрессу 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.12.2013, 15:44:38 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
Fyn2013, По тэгу title можно определить заголовок страницы 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.12.2013, 16:08:08 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
UsmanFyn2013, По тэгу title можно определить заголовок страницы Код: java 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. 29. 30. 31. 32. 33. 34. 35. 36.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.12.2013, 16:39:23 |
|
||
|
Поиск по сайту на java
|
|||
|---|---|---|---|
|
#18+
замечательно, спасибо вам!!!)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 01.12.2013, 16:46:21 |
|
||
|
|

start [/forum/topic.php?fid=59&msg=38484271&tid=2128095]: |
0ms |
get settings: |
4ms |
get forum list: |
14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
982ms |
get topic data: |
14ms |
get forum data: |
3ms |
get page messages: |
86ms |
get tp. blocked users: |
2ms |
| others: | 198ms |
| total: | 1309ms |

| 0 / 0 |
